> create a skin descriptor to contain meta-data about the skin
> ------------------------------------------------------------

> currently, a skin is a jar containing at least {{META-INF/maven/site.vm}}, 
> which is the Velocity template file
> adding a skin descriptor (as XML with Modello, to be consistent with Maven 
> style) would permit meta-data definition.
> The first case I see is Doxia Site Tools prerequisites, to have a skin make 
> clear that it requires a newer version of Doxia Site Tools (which is a 
> dependency of maven-site-plugin = what end-users see): this would permit 
> newer Doxia Site Tools versions to provide new features for skins (like 
> DOXIASITETOOLS-150) and skins using these features without fearing failing 
> because being used in older maven-site-plugin versions
> this would also create a new "skin-model" module that would give us a natural 
> place to document practices around skins
